Albariño Wine Guide

Honest confession time. Albariño is the one wine that I always have challenges with on blind tasting exams. Albariño (al-bah-reen-yo) is a refreshing, light-bodied white Spanish wine from the northwestern corner of Spain in the region of Rias Baixas, Galicia. Albariño wines showcase lemon zest, apricot, melon, grapefruit, white peach, nectarine, and honeysuckle. You may […]
